Output 3dc96deddb2d12e7e6f4d594879646df04b4ff25f9b26e89fc21006e0cf970f7:1

value
1704668
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0dd9f38bcf6a74f4fb4acd193ad579b4427a06ddedff6ec0997af695a1838354
address
bc1pphvl8z70df60f762e5vn44tek3p85pkaahlkasye0tmftgvrsd2qez4k62
transaction
3dc96deddb2d12e7e6f4d594879646df04b4ff25f9b26e89fc21006e0cf970f7
spent
true